The International Falcon Breeders Auction, hosted by the Saudi Falcons Club in Malham, north of Riyadh, welcomed Ambassador Morino on August 9, 2025. The event, running until August 25, gathers elite falcon breeders worldwide, reflecting Saudi Arabia’s commitment to cultural preservation and global collaboration.

Ambassador Morino was greeted by Talal AlShamaisi, CEO of the Saudi Falcons Club, who detailed the auction’s significance. The envoy toured pavilions, admired rare falcon species, and explored the “Falconer of the Future” exhibit.
